Liverpool's Dominant Win Over Norwich City in FA Cup: A Recap

Recap of Liverpool's impressive 5-2 victory over Norwich City in the FA Cup, including standout performances and match analysis.

Liverpool cruised to a 5-2 victory over Norwich City in the FA Cup, showcasing a stellar performance by Curtis Jones, Darwin Nunez, Diogo Jota, Virgil van Dijk, and Ryan Gravenberch. The match marked the start of Jurgen Klopp's farewell journey as Liverpool's manager. The FA Cup, known for its inclusivity from non-league to EFL teams, witnessed Liverpool dominating the field.

Liverpool's triumph over Norwich City was a commendable display of skill, securing their spot in the fifth round with a resounding 5-2 win.
